Buenos Aires to Istanbul by Air freight

The quickest way to get from Buenos Aires to Istanbul by plane will take about 16h 41m and departs from Minister Pistarini International Airport (EZE) and arrives into İstanbul Airport (IST). There are flights departing every 1-2 days on this route. Turkish Airlines is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with flights departing every 1-2 days.

Buenos Aires to Istanbul by Container ship

The quickest way to get from Buenos Aires to Istanbul by ship will take about 69 days 10h and departs from San Antonio (CLSAI) and arrives into Izmit (TRIZT). There are vessels departing every 2-4 weeks on this route. Wan Hai is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with vessels departing every 2-4 weeks.
